>WL1
Sequel to SML2 with even more exploration and secrets, and instead of bouncing around and shit like Mario, you smash the fuck out of everything. It has big expressive sprites and in general, is very fun.

>VBWL
Kind of like Wario 1, but short and linear instead, geared towards replayability. Your moveset is expanded, the powerups are genuinely great, and the game has some delightful pixelart.

>WL2
Wario gets a massive speed and power boost to even his most powerful form in 1, and is also now immortal, which means some things that would kill or damage Wario now give him an alternate state necessary to find secrets (you get set on fire and autorun and need to burn things down, or you become flat and hover so you can squeeze by tight spots). The game is as open-ended as 1, perhaps even more so, because WL2 is a cyoa structured game with multiple paths based on secret finding, with even a different stry and ending. Very unique game.

>WL3
Kind of like 2, except it's Metroidvania for some reason? You start depowered and slowly grow more powerful as you explore an open-ish world with multiple paths you have to access with either new abilities or treasures. Kinda more linear than 2, but it starts kinda branching towards the middle of the game.

>WL4
Wario can die again, but is also more poweful than ever, with some very satisfying changes to his moveset, and a beautiful looking and sounding trippy, surreal world to explore. You're required to gather treasure and speedrun stages in order to advance, and you even get two harder difficulties, so it's definitely the hardest Wario. Just an amazing game overall, crazy this is so early in the GBA lifespan. Crazy pixelart and music in this bad boy.
